Richard Sjoquist
The author was a public secondary and tertiary level educator for 38 years in the U.S., China, and South Korea until his recent retirement. He taught in the academic fields of applied linguistics, L1 English, EFL, world and American history, crosscultural communication, creative writing, curriculum studies, and pedagogy. In addition, he was both a senior editor and principal writer for a major educational press in Beijing and the Ministry of Education and a volunteer with Project Hope, serving poor rural children in China. He holds a B.A. from The University of Wisconsin at Madison, a M.A. from The University of Texas at Austin, and a Ph.D from The University of Hawaii at Manoa. This is his first novel. He currently resides in his hometown of Madison, Wisconsin.
